2007 GILERA Nexus 125 Scooter Pictures
1600 x 1200 pixels




The practicality of a scooter, the sensations of a motorcycle and Gilera style. A new 125cc displacement and even more load capacity thanks to a sizeable underseat storage bay that holds two helmets make the Nexus 125 a practical, fun and sporty GT, which is the ideal companion for in town traffic and an exuberant ride on tougher out-of-town rides.

Specifications

Model: Gilera Nexus 125
Year: 2007
Category: Scooter
Rating: 69.3 out of 100. Show full rating and compare with other bikes
Safety: See our safety campaign with the high safety rated bikes in this category.

Engine and transmission
Displacement: 1124.00 ccm (68.59 cubic inches)
Engine type: Single cylinder
Stroke: 4
Power: 14.50 HP (10.6 kW)) @ 9750 RPM
Torque: 11.70 Nm (1.2 kgf-m or 8.6 ft.lbs) @ 8000 RPM
Compression: 12.0:1
Bore x stroke: 57.0 x 46.0 mm (2.2 x 1.8 inches)
Ignition: Electronic inductive discharge
Starter: Electric
Cooling system: Liquid
Gearbox: Automatic
Clutch: Dry centrifugal type with damping plugs

Physical measures
Dry weight: 186.0 kg (410.1 pounds)
Seat height: 810 mm (31.9 inches) If adjustable, lowest setting.
Overall length: 2,100 mm (82.7 inches)
Overall width: 780 mm (30.7 inches)
Wheelbase: 1,530 mm (60.2 inches)

Chassis and dimensions
Frame type: Double cradle trellis made of high-strength steel tubes
Front suspension: Telescopic hydraulic fork with ö 35 mm shafts; 94 mm travel
Front suspension travel: 94 mm (3.7 inches)
Rear suspension: Double hydraulic shock absorber with four-position spring preload; 76 mm travel
Rear suspension travel: 76 mm (3.0 inches)
Front tyre dimensions: 120/70-14
Rear tyre dimensions: 140/60-14
Front brakes: Single disc. Stainless steel disk, ö 260 mm, two-piston floating caliper
Front brakes diameter: 260 mm (10.2 inches)
Rear brakes diameter: 240 mm (9.4 inches)

Speed and acceleration
Top speed: 103.0 km/h (64.0 mph)
Power/weight ratio: 0.0780 HP/kg

Other specifications
Fuel capacity: 15.00 litres (3.96 gallons)
